Azalea Campground
Reservations are accepted at Azalea Campground, making it convenient for campers to secure their spot in advance. The campground offers both tent and RV camping sites, accommodating different preferences and needs. It is advisable to book early, especially during peak seasons, to ensure availability.
The best time to visit Azalea Campground is during the summer and fall months when the weather is pleasant and perfect for outdoor activities. The campground is surrounded by stunning natural beauty, with picturesque trails for hiking and biking. Visitors can explore the nearby Sequoia and Kings Canyon National Parks, which offer breathtaking views of giant sequoias and rugged mountains. Wildlife enthusiasts can also enjoy bird watching and spot various native species in the area.
While camping at Azalea Campground, it is essential to be cautious of wildlife encounters, especially bears. Proper food storage in bear-proof containers is highly recommended to prevent any unwanted interactions. Additionally, campers should be mindful of fire safety regulations and ensure all fires are fully extinguished before leaving the area.

Camping essentials & Leave No Trace
- Pack it in, pack it out
- Take all trash, food scraps, and gear back with you to keep campsites clean and protect wildlife.
- Respect wildlife
- Observe animals from a distance, store food securely, and never feed wildlife to maintain natural behavior and safety.
- Know before you go
- Check weather, fire restrictions, trail conditions, and permit requirements to ensure a safe and well-planned trip.
- Minimize campfire impact
- Use established fire rings, keep fires small, fully extinguish them, or opt for a camp stove when fires are restricted.
- Leave what you find
- Preserve natural and cultural features by avoiding removal of plants, rocks, artifacts, or other elements of the environment.
